Are you ready to embark on an exciting journey as a Senior Therapy Radiographer at our state-of-the-art cancer care centre located in Milton Keynes? Join our dedicated team at GenesisCare UK and be part of something extraordinary.

The Role:

This is a full time, permanent position based at our Milton Keynes centre in Linford Wood.

As the Senior Therapy Radiographer, you are responsible for supporting all aspects of the pathway of every patient receiving external beam radiotherapy in the centre and to support the Lead Therapy Radiographer/Centre Leader with leadership of their team. This is your opportunity to make a meaningful impact and develop your career.

What You'll Do:

  • Working in different areas of the GenesisCare treatment centre so that all operational objectives and standards are achieved, and the reputation of GenesisCare for exceptional service and outcomes is always maintained.
  • Working closely with the clinical team of Lead Radiographer, Lead Physicist, Senior Dosimetrist, other Radiographers, Nurses and administration staff in all aspects of the radiotherapy process.

What You'll Have:

Experience and Skills:

  • Able to demonstrate post qualification experience
  • Experience and understanding of UK radiotherapy
  • Previous experience within all aspects of radiotherapy; quality assurance, pre-treatment, and treatment
  • Evidence of effective staff liaison and co-operative working
  • Evidence of empathetic and a holistic approach to patient care
  • Previous experience working in private health sector – advantageous
  • Prior experience with resolving complaints satisfactorily
  • Experience of proactively evolving radiotherapy techniques
  • A range of radiotherapy clinical skills
  • Evidence of effective organisational, interpersonal and communication skills
  • Strong relationship building skills
  • Able to make independent judgments/decisions, ability to solve problems
  • Ability to work flexibly to achieve GenesisCare business objectives
  • Able to act as a trainer and mentor for new/more junior staff

Qualifications and Knowledge:

  • DCR (T) or BSc (Hons) in Radiotherapy (or equivalent)
  • HCPC registration
  • Evidence of continuing professional development
  • Some knowledge of report writing

Who We Are:

GenesisCare UK is the leading provider of private oncology services in the UK, pioneering a transformation in cancer care. Through innovative, personalised treatments, we are enhancing patient quality of life, life expectancy, and overall survival rates.

We take an integrated approach to cancer care, focusing on treating the whole patient, not just the cancer. Our personalised treatment programmes include wellbeing services in partnership with Penny Brohn UK and exercise medicine, proven to enhance patient outcomes.

Collaborating with universities and leading clinicians globally, we're dedicated to researching and developing improved cancer treatments. Our UK clinical trials programme aims to broaden access to new therapies.
